4-(4-Nitrophenylsulfonyl)aniline
4-(4-Nitrophenylsulfonyl)aniline (CAS 1948-92-1) is a chemical compound with the molecular formula O2NC6H4SO2C6H4NH2 and a molecular weight of 278.28 g/mol. This sulfone derivative serves as a valuable building block in organic synthesis. Its structure, featuring both a nitro group and an aniline moiety, allows for diverse chemical transformations. It is primarily utilized in research and development for the creation of novel chemical entities and functional materials.

| Molecular weight | 278.28 |
|---|---|
| Linear formula | O2NC6H4SO2C6H4NH2 |
| Assay | 96% |
| Melting point | 169-171 °C(lit.) |
| Water hazard class (WGK, DE) | 3 |
|---|---|
| Hazard codes (EU) | Xi |
| Risk statements (R) | 36/37/38 |
| Safety statements (S) | 26-37/39 |

How should 4-(4-Nitrophenylsulfonyl)aniline be handled?
+
Handle with care. This compound is an irritant to the eyes, respiratory system, and skin (Xi; R36/37/38). Ensure adequate ventilation and wear appropriate protective gloves and eye/face protection (S26; S37/39).
